在Java中,Scanner 类本身并没有直接提供获取 char 类型数据的方法。不过,你可以通过以下步骤使用 Scanner 类来获取 char 类型的字符: 导入Scanner类: java import java.util.Scanner; 创建一个Scanner对象: java Scanner scanner = new Scanner(System.in); 调用Scanner对象的next()方法读取一个字符: java...
packagemethod;importjava.util.Scanner;publicclassDemo04{publicstaticvoidmain(String[] args){Scannersanner=newScanner(System.in);inta=sanner.nextInt();charoperator=sanner.next().charAt(0);//scanner读入字符intb=sanner.nextInt(); calculator(a,operator,b); }publicstaticdoublecalculator(inta,charoperato...
import java.util.Scanner; publicclassday06_1 {publicstaticvoidmain(String[] args) {//创建一个Scanner类的对象Scanner sc =newScanner(System.in);//提示用户输入System.out.print("请输入int型的数值:");//定义一个变量接收用户输入的数inti =sc.nextInt(); System.out.println("用户输入:"+i); } ...
import java.util.LinkedHashMap;import java.util.Map;import java.util.Scanner;public class Test { public static void main(String args[]) { Scanner sc = new Scanner(System.in); System.out.print("请输入字符串:"); String str = sc.next(); Map<String, Integer> m...
scanner对象在调用nextIn()方法时,控制台会让用户输入数字,会打断循环,并不会一直循环下去。 三、ArrayList类 ArrayList,这是Java里的一个集合。 前面学了数组,我们知道数组的一个特点,就是它的长度是固定的。 那ArrayList这个类就可以理解成一个长度可变的集合。
在Java中使用Scanner提供多行输入可以通过以下步骤实现: 导入Scanner类:在代码的开头,使用import java.util.Scanner;语句导入Scanner类。 创建Scanner对象:使用Scanner scanner = new Scanner(System.in);语句创建Scanner对象,其中System.in表示从标准输入流中读取数据。 读取多行输入:使用scanner.nextLine()方法读取一行输...
import java.util.Scanner; //Scanner类 表示 简单文本扫描器, 在java.util 包 public class Input { public static void main(String[] args) { //2. 创建 Scanner 对象,new 创建一个对象 Scanner myscanner = new Scanner(System.in); //3. 接受用户的输入,使用相关方法 ...
在java中使用Scanner进行Web抓取 在Java中使用Scanner进行Web抓取是一种常见的网络爬虫技术,它可以用来从指定的URL中获取数据。Scanner类是Java标准库中的一个输入类,可以用来读取来自各种来源的输入,包括Web页面。 使用Scanner进行Web抓取的步骤如下: 导入所需的Java类库: 代码语言:txt 复制 import java.net.URL; imp...
import java.util.Scanner; /** 通过输入nextLine字符串当作一个方法进行封装起来,然后调用这个方法 */ public class ScannerDemo { private static Scanner extracted() { returnnewScanner(System.in); } public static int getInt() { Scannerscanner=extracted();returnscanner.nextInt(); ...
java的Scanner类总结 java中的从键盘输入主要是依赖于Scanner类,下面将介绍Scanner类的一些比较常见并且重要的方法。 1.nextInt()/nextFloat()/nextDouble()... 这种只会读取一个数值,并且不会读取最后的换行符'\n' 2.String nextLine() 扫描的是一行数据,并且当作字符串来处理,不会读取最后的换行符'\n' 3...